Appealing MS63 1829 Andrew Jackson Indian Peace Medal, Second Size, Second Reverse
1829 Andrew Jackson Indian Peace Medal, Second Size, Second Reverse, Julian-IP-15, MS63 NGC. Bronzed copper, 125.7 gm, rim 5.3 mm, 62.3 mm. Dies by Moritz Fürst and John Reich. Obverse bust right, rev. clasped hands, pipe and tomahawk, PEACE AND FRIENDSHIP, flat-topped A's, finger pointing between F and R. A richly colored mahogany-brown piece with some prooflikeness remaining, light carbon and generous eye appeal. Complete with NGC Photo Certificate specifying "Reverse Dies of 1846." Another delightful example of this popular and rare series of medals featuring "Old Hickory" himself, Andrew Jackson. A "Nice AU" example in the illustrious Kessler-Spangenberger sale, (NASCA, 4/1981, lot 1605), realized $170 against a presale estimate of $100.
